как это осуществить?
Доброго времени суток форумчане , вот такая идея возникла , на сайте хочу разместить грубо говоря машину , и когда на определенную деталь авто нажимаешь , чтобы давало полное описание детали , это возможно?
|
возможно
|
Цитата:
|
|
картинка будет целой , при наведении на часть детали она должна выделятся , а при нажатии на часть , показывать некую информацию , вот как это сделать
|
может есть прога , которая часть картинки выделяет , и туда можно вставить код?
|
zUnnika,
Делал похожее с помощью canvas, и map. Была интерактивная карта России по регионам. надо было при наведении на регион показать его данные. С помощью map определял наведение на регион, а затем на canvas выделял его контур (брал его из map) |
tsigel , а как это на картинке реализовать? как выделить определенный фрагмент картинки и вставиь код?
|
Вы ссылку о картах изображений читали?
Создаете карту на свой машине, это будут горячие области на ней. Этим областям можно назначит обработчики событий. А дальше полет фантазии, можно иметь изображения узлов автомобиля отличающиеся по яркости или по цвету. А можно их сделать еще немного большими по размеру, анимируя размер их от равного исходному к их полному при показе. Эти изображения узлов, это формат PNG24 и с абсолютным позиционированием относительно исходного изображения. |
laimas , я понял это все , но я не пойму одного , есть картинка , мне ее резать придется ,чтобы определенную область описать , или как то через функцию можно ее выделить?
|
laimas , именно иметь каждую деталь машины и как пазл складывать, описывая каждую делать ,или же по другому?
|
Боже мой, вы прочли о map? Добавить их изображению можно и в редакторе, хотя и не все имеют такой инструмент, или же в сети найдете такой онлайн генератор. Что резать то? Все, после этого у вас будут определены карты, этим областям и навешивайте обработчик.
А детали, которые надо будет показать при наведении/щелчке по карте, это отдельные изображения, и тут можно поступать 1000 и одним способом, в смысле фантазии. Что не понятного? |
laimas,
все , догнал) спасибо просто не понятно было как картинку на сектора разбить ) внимательней прочитал и все понял, большое вам спасибо |
Часовой пояс GMT +3, время: 19:45. |